College teachers face challenge of creating community in online learning

by Amy West, KHAS-TV

More and more Nebraskans are taking college courses online, but are they missing out on the classroom community? A new study out of the University of Nebraska–Lincoln says yes. Previously scholars have said students perform better if they feel connected in the classroom. Is that consistent with this study? Actually no.

UNL graduate student Robert Vavala who authored the study said online undergrads learn just as well without strong bonds with classmates. But as our world become more and more digital how important is it to create those classroom bonds online?
